public ViewResult EditHallRooms(int sportsHallId) { SportsHall aHall = sportsHallRepository.Halls.FirstOrDefault(h => h.ID == sportsHallId); EditHallRoomsViewModel roomViewModel = new EditHallRoomsViewModel() { SportsHallId = sportsHallId, Rooms = aHall.Rooms.ToList() }; return(View("EditHallRooms", roomViewModel)); }
public ViewResult EditHallRooms(EditHallRoomsViewModel viewModel) { SportsHall aHall = sportsHallRepository.Halls.FirstOrDefault(h => h.ID == viewModel.SportsHallId); aHall.Rooms = viewModel.Rooms; if (ModelState.IsValid) { sportsHallRepository.EditSportsHall(aHall); return(View("SportsHallList", sportsHallRepository.Halls)); } else { return(View("SportsHallList", sportsHallRepository.Halls)); } }